What is Planning and Its Objectives
Planning is a key management function that involves setting goals, defining strategies, and ensuring efficient resource allocation. It provides a roadmap for achieving success by answering essential questions: What needs to be done? How? When? And by whom?
Effective planning reduces risks, improves coordination, and helps organizations adapt to changes. It can be categorized into strategic (long-term), tactical (mid-term), and operational (short-term) planning.
Key Objectives of Planning
✅ Setting Clear Goals: Planning ensures that goals are clear, measurable, and achievable, helping organizations stay focused. Example: If a company wants to increase market share by 10%, planning will define steps such as marketing strategies and product improvements.
✅ Reducing Uncertainty: Through forecasting, planning helps businesses prepare for economic shifts, competition, and technological changes, reducing risks and ensuring stability.
✅ Efficient Resource Allocation: Resources such as money, time, and manpower are allocated strategically to maximize productivity and minimize waste.
✅ Improving Coordination: Planning aligns different departments, ensuring that all teams work toward a common goal, reducing conflicts and improving teamwork.
✅ Increasing Efficiency: By streamlining processes and eliminating inefficiencies, planning helps organizations optimize workflows and enhance productivity.
✅ Helping in Decision-Making: Planning provides a reference for making informed business decisions, avoiding impulsive choices, and improving problem-solving.
✅ Encouraging Innovation: Forward-thinking planning fosters creativity by encouraging new ideas and strategies for business growth.
✅ Setting Performance Standards: Planning helps measure performance by comparing actual results with objectives, allowing organizations to make necessary adjustments.
